Important changes regarding hour-flexibility and fixed-term contracts.

On 30.3.2015 CONFCOMMERCIO, FILCAMS – CGIL, FISASCAT – CISL, UILTUCS – UIL signed the agreement hypothesis for the renewal of the c.c.n.l of Tertiary Trade and Services, which has been active since April 1st 2015, with validity up until December 31st of 2017.

Among the changes, there has been a pay increase equal to 85.00 gross for 4th level (with relative re-standardisation of other contract levels) which will be paid in 5 tranches:

- 15,00 euro starting April 1st of 2015;

- 15,00 euro starting November 1st of 2015;

- 15,00 euro starting June 1st of 2016;

- 16,00 euro starting November 1st o0f 2016;

- 24,00 euro starting August 1st of 2017.

The new contract script provides, inter alia, for the possible fulfilment of a maximum of 44 working hours per week, without overtime, for a maximum of 16 weeks: thus the surplus work performed is be recovered within the following 12 months.

Amongst the other changes, a fixed-term contract for employment support is expected.

In fact, the script includes regulation on subdivision in the case of hiring “weak” personnel such as the unemployed or those who have completed apprenticeship without a stabilization.

For these people a fixed-term contract of 12 months can be stipulated, with a subdivision of 2 levels the first 6 months and a subdivision of one level for the subsequent 6 months.

The subdivision of a level is granted for a further 24 months in the case of subsequent transformation into an open-ended contract.
Furthermore the parties have adopted the 2014 governance agreement for the reorganization of bilateral territorial entities and the appreciation of national contractual welfare.
